Guest guest Posted May 17, 2004 Report Share Posted May 17, 2004 MARTHA WASHINGTON'S COLONIAL CHOCOLATE Mix to a smooth paste in a saucepan... 4 tbsp. cocoa in a little cold water Stir in... 2 cups water 1/3 cup sugar 2 cups milk Bring to a boil and blend in... 2 tbsp. cornstarch dissolved in a little cold milk Boil 3 minutes longer.Remove from heat and set in warm place. Beat until light and foamy... 1 egg with 1/2 cup hot water Pour half of egg mixture into a pitcher. Blend in... 1/2 tsp. vanilla Add hot chocolate slowly. Pour remaining egg mixture over top. Serve at once. Amount: 6 servings.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
